Pokémon is teaming up with the virtual pet genre, introducing an official Tamagotchi-style device. This twist on classic gameplay is set to capture the hearts of fans starting in 2025, blending nostalgia with new gameplay methods.

What Makes It Different?

The upcoming Pokémon virtual pet stands out with its distinct mechanics. Unlike traditional Tamagotchis focused solely on care, this new device incorporates battling and training elements reminiscent of Digimon.
